Russian Art Focus: How to reach out to unexplored art territories

The invited experts will discuss the role (if any) that former Soviet republics play in the international contemporary art scene.

This event gives participants an opportunity to discuss what role the former Soviet republics are playing (or not playing) on the international contemporary art scene.

Russian Art Focus’ core mission is to highlight what is happening on the Russian art scene, both inside Russia and beyond its borders.

This online resource aims to reach wider audience and explore the art that is being created in countries that have for decades been culturally tied to Russia and how these links can be sustained today.

The discussion will be of interest to both professionals and the general public.

Russian Art Focus is a monthly online publication founded by Inna Bazhenova (The Art Newspaper) and Dmitry Aksenov (the Aksenov Family Foundation) and produced by a team of journalists, critics and researchers. The mission is to provide a well–reported, timely overview of the Russian art scene to international audiences.

Russian Art Focus is a free on-line publication, distributed as a newsletter.
